    We were back in Atlanta and the first place I knew I wanted to eat at again was Strikeout. The food is so flavorful, they genuinely have some of the best food around. We got hot lemon peeper wings, Cajun ranch fries and the fried pickles. We devoured everything because it was just that good. The staff is also so kind, and there's plenty of seating to sit and eat. However, the reason we can't give 5 stars is because the portion sizes compared to last time were just much smaller. The wings were tiny! I had never seen wings that small before.

    I wanted to try the lemon pepper wet wings in Atlanta and this place had an amazing lunch special for $10 that included a drink. I got the 6 wings and upgraded to the cajun ranch fries for $2. The wings were cooked perfectly with a crispy skin and there's extra sauce below. The fries were amazing with a nice sweet and flavor profile. The restaurant is clean overall, but they could provide more trash cans or empty them so customers don't have to stack trash.

    Had them for lunch today. The location is off the street so you will have to find street parking. I had 3 separate orders so the wait time was about 50 minutes. They have alcohol but its lunch time so the wait was annoying. Its spacious and plenty of tables. When the food arrived, it was delish. I got the lemon pepper hen with a side of okra. Hen was cooked perfectly. I spent 20 total and tried the blue raspberry drink. My only dislike was the bread. It came with 2 slices of white texas toast but it wasn't toasted. I would of preffered toasted because my bread was soggy from the sauces. Outside of that, I will definitely be back. Also their lunch specials prices are between $12 and $20. Customer service was okay.

    We stumbled across this place last minute on the way home from the State Farm Arena! The inside was cute and had a bar. The drink selection didn't look like a lot but it was a nice touch. My husband and I were greeted by a lady at the counter who took our order. At first she was a little soft spoken and flat but eventually warmed up to us. I had the lemon pepper wet with Cajun ranch fries and my husband had the hot lemon pepper with Cajun ranch fries. Let me tell you their definition of hot is truly hot!! My LP wings were fresh and crispy and we loved the fries. We have found it hard to come across real Cajun ranch fries in ATL being that it's such a bham wing spot staple. We waited for our food for at least 15 - 20 mins and headed home to grub. The prices were a little on the higher end but then again it's 2024 and everything's expensive. I would def return this spot to try their sweet and sassy wing flavor and fish!

    I got the lemon pepper wet on chicken tenders. The tenders were good and breaded well. The sauce was very saucy. The tenders were sitting in pools of oil which was fine, but kinda made them soggy. The sauce was also very salty. Not unbearably so, but I didn't love it. I got their hot wing sauce on the side to dip and it was awesome. If I return, I will get that sauce next time. Their fries are great and their lunch special is $9.99 and hard to beat. Service did take longer than expected for a fast casual restaurant and trash can was overflowing and the employees didn't seem to notice.

We arrived there exactly at 5 PM, when it opens, but there was already a pretty extensive line. A little outside the entrance, they check your ID, which I had no idea was a thing. So make sure you have your IDs with you and are 21+. There's a bar area for drinks and a separate counter where you will order and pay for your food. (They make it pretty explicit that you can't get wings to-go.) Find a seat, and once your food is ready, they'll announce your name, and you pick up your food from the window. FOOD: We got wings in the flavors of lemon pepper (dry rub), sun-dried tomato (dry rub), buffalo lemon pepper (wet), and jerk buffalo (wet). I will say that I definitely preferred the wet wings to the dry wings. I found the dry wings to be a little too salty. In my opinion, the wings and the cook on them were just okay. I wasn't blown away or anything. Maybe the relatively cheap beer and the vibes help draw in all the appeal. TLDR// I don't think I had the greatest wings of all time here, but the vibes were really casual and pleasant. I'm glad I was able to try a place so beloved by locals.
